Підсумковий тест з теми "Алгоритми та програми. Python"

Додано: 24 квітня
Предмет: Інформатика, 8 клас
18 запитань
Запитання 1

Яким знаком в Python позначається операція присвоювання?

варіанти відповідей

+

-

)))

=

Запитання 2

Як називається алгоритмічна структура, за якої дії виконуються послідовно одна за одною без пропусків або повторень?

варіанти відповідей

Слідування

Розгалуження

Повторення

Запитання 3

Як називається алгоритмічна структура, в якій виконання певної послідовності дій залежить від істинності умови?

варіанти відповідей

Слідування

Розгалуження

Повторення

Запитання 4

Як називається алгоритмічна структура, в якій та сама послідовність дій може виконатися кілька разів?

варіанти відповідей

Слідування

Розгалуження

Повторення

Запитання 5

Для чого призначена функція input () ?

варіанти відповідей

Перетворення одного типу даних в інший

Для виведення результату

Для введення даних із клавіатури

Запитання 6

Яке призначення функції print () ?

варіанти відповідей

Введення даних з клавіатури

Виведення тексту у вікно консолі

Створення дробового числа з рядка

Запитання 7

На малюнку зображена блок-схема:

варіанти відповідей

лінійного розгалуження

повного розгалуження

неповного розгалуження

програмного алгоритм

Запитання 8

 Виконання повного розгалуження відбувається так:

варіанти відповідей

якщо результат виконання цієї команди НІ: то виконавець виконує послідовність команд 1, якщо результат виконання цієї команди ТАК: то виконавець виконує послідовність команд 2

якщо результат виконання цієї команди Так: то виконавець виконує послідовність команд 1, якщо результат виконання цієї команди Ні: то виконавець виконує послідовність команд 2

якщо результат виконання цієї команди Так: то виконавець виконує послідовність команд 2, якщо результат виконання цієї команди Ні: то виконавець виконує послідовність команд 1

Запитання 9

Якого значення набуде змінна a після виконання наведеного фрагменту програми, якщо змінна x має значення 0:

варіанти відповідей

1

2

0

3

Запитання 10

Потрібно сформувати послідовність таких чисел:

1 3 5 7 9

Виберіть функцію, яка це робить:

варіанти відповідей

 range(1,10,2)

 range(1,9,2)

 range(1,9)

 range(10)

Запитання 11

Вкажіть результат виконання коду: 

варіанти відповідей

5

8

3

2

Запитання 12

Скільки разів повторяться команди тіла циклу в поданому алгоритмі?

варіанти відповідей

4

8

7

5

жодного разу

Запитання 13

Які службові слова використовуються в команді розгалуження? 

варіанти відповідей

while

else

if

for

Запитання 14

Під час піднесення до степеня використовують символ операції:

варіанти відповідей

*

 //

**

 %

Запитання 15

print ("5+7=", 5+7) який результат виконання програми?

варіанти відповідей

5+47

5+7=12

"5+7"

 "5+7=", 5+7

("5+7=", 5+7) 

Запитання 16

print (3+4) який результат виконання програми?

варіанти відповідей

3+4 

("3+4")

 "3+4" 

7

(3+4) 

Запитання 17

Оберіть результат виконання програми в Python:

print ('10+3*2')

варіанти відповідей

10+3*2

16

26

19

print ('10+3*2')

Запитання 18

Команда щоб установити червоний колір олівця.

варіанти відповідей

reset()

down()

right(90)

color("red")

Створюйте онлайн-тести
для контролю знань і залучення учнів
до активної роботи у класі та вдома

Створити тест